How It Is Organized
The learning path begins with the 12‑module course, which builds a solid theoretical base before moving into hands‑on case studies. Once you have the concepts, you open the Implementation Toolkit. The toolkit is divided into ten practitioner‑journey folders, each designed to produce a tangible outcome for fraud risk analytics:
- Getting Started - defines scope, assembles the project team, and runs the Fraud Maturity Assessment.
- Assessment & Planning - completes the Gap Analysis and creates the Decision Framework.
- Models & Frameworks - delivers the Actuarial Risk Exposure Matrix and selects predictive models.
- Processes & Handoffs - builds the Process Runbook and Stakeholder Mapping Sheet.
- Operations & Execution - populates the Implementation Roadmap and real‑time alert workflow.
- Performance & KPIs - configures the KPI Dashboard and defines measurement cadence.
- Quality & Compliance - fills out the Audit Checklist and aligns with regulatory requirements.
- Sustainment & Support - sets up continuous monitoring, drift detection, and model retraining plans.
- Advanced Topics - explores network‑graph fraud detection and adversarial testing.
- Reference - provides the Reference Registry and Quick Reference Cards for ongoing use.
